HYPOT(3M) HYPOT(3M) НАЗВАНИЕ hypot - функция, вычисляющая эвклидово расстояние СИНТАКСИС |#include | |double hypot (x, y) |double x, y; ОПИСАНИЕ Функция hypot возвращает значение sqrt (x*x + y*y) которое вычисляется по методу, исключающему "паразит- ные" переполнения. СМ. ТАКЖЕ matherr(3M). ДИАГНОСТИКА Если к переполнению приводит попытка представления кор- ректного результирующего значения, то функция hypot возвращает значение HUGE [см. intro(3)], а внешней пе- ременной errno присваивается значение ERANGE. Изложенная процедура обработки ошибок может быть изме- нена посредством функции matherr(3M).